Description
Conceived as a ‘nomadic’ project, The Beak has spent several years creating unfiltered, seasonally-inspired beer with friends at some the greatest UK breweries, including North Brew Co, Partizan, Beavertown, Burning Sky and Northern Monk. We've now laid roots in our hometown of Lewes in East Sussex, where we've built a 15-BBL neighbourhood brewery and taproom with a mixed-fermentation project and weekend street food canteen.
